"Bud Cort (born March 29, 1948) is an American film and stage actor, writer, and director. He is best known for his portrayals of Harold in Hal Ashby's 1971 film Harold and Maude and the titular \"hero\" in Robert Altman's 1970 film Brewster McCloud. Both films have large cult followings today."@en . . . . . "Bud Cort is a courtroom show in the vein of Mock Trial with J. Reinhold, hosted by actor Bud Cort.
